Dr Helen KP Barker
BDS (Otago) MDS (Perio) (Otago), FRACDS (Perio)
Periodontist
NEW ZEALAND
Dr Helen English completed her Masters in Periodontology with Distinction from the University of Otago in 2005, gaining her Royal Australasian College Fellowship that same year. She subsequently established Nelson Periodontics, the only private specialist periodontal and dental implant surgery practice in the top of the South Island.
Although full-time clinical practice is her primary interest, she maintains various research commitments and is a committee member of the Australian & New Zealand Academy of Periodontists and the New Zealand Society of Periodontology. She has lectured at numerous conferences including the International Academy of Periodontology, ANZAP, NZDHA, NZAO meetings and the Royal Australasian College of Dental Surgeons Convocation - in addition to regular NZDA branch meeting presentations.
She was recently awarded a New Zealand Dental Research Foundation Grant to undertake specialist practice-based research into subgingival delivery devices for periodontitis lesions in conjunction with the University of Otago and the University of Zurich, Switzerland. She has a passion for learning, for educating her patients, and for sharing her knowledge with colleagues.
